Good morning Mr. Sekowski,
My name is Joshua Surprenant, I am the Community Engagement
Director and Public Works Services Deputy Director for the City of Cape
Canaveral. I was copied on your communications with Council Member Wes
Morrison regarding the path that leads to the beach between Ocean Oaks
and Ocean Woods. I have received multiple emails and phone calls
regarding this area in the last two weeks from several interested
parties. I am currently working to research this beach path to determine
the ownership and maintenance responsibility.
From conversations with multiple City departments and some
independent research I’ve found that
· According to the City arborist, it was approximately
five years ago when he was last in the Ridgewood Ave City roadway
easement planting new tress and removing Brazilian Pepper Trees. (in
faded purple area below)
o This tree work was required by Ocean Oaks as part of a tree
mitigation agreement in 2011
· NO work was authorized on Ocean Woods property (in red
below) – including the beach path (blue line below)
· According to the Brevard County Property Appraisers
website, sent to you by Council Member Morrison, the beach path crosses
Ocean Woods property (in red), a City roadway easement (circled in
yellow) and ends in Ocean Oaks property (circled in blue).
o https://www.bcpao.us/map/?r=2430591
My next steps are to work with the City Attorney to explore
titles, and have the easements/lines surveyed. As a longtime resident of
Brevard County and Cape Canaveral (who learned to surf at this beach
access), I was never under the impression that this access was
maintained by the City. City beach access/crossover areas are well
maintained, landscaped, signed, have WastePro cans/trash service, etc.
This beach path is not on the Public Works Services beach area/crossover
maintenance schedule, and it has not been included in the Capital
Improvement Plan.
Any documents you (or your HOA) can supply me regarding land
use, easements, etc would be of great help to me. It may be determined
that the responsibility and maintenance of this beach path does not fall
on the City, at which time I envision a meeting between Ocean Woods and
Ocean Oaks HOA presidents and myself taking place.
****On a side note I have received multiple reports of golf cart
use on this beach path, and on the beach immediately exiting this path.
Motorized vehicles are prohibited on the dunes and ocean beach unless
such vehicle is propelled by nonmotorized power
<mailto:https://library.municode.com/fl/cape_canaveral/codes/code_of_ord
inances?nodeId=SPAGEOR_CH74TRVE_ARTIINGE_S74-1TROTSTHI> , and as a
result I have contacted the Brevard County Sheriff’s Office to monitor
the area for violations. If you could help me spread the word on the
golf cart use it would be appreciated.****
Please contact me should you have any further questions. I will
keep all parties up-to-date on my findings.
